Offer description

Location: On-site working at our state of the art labs in Bristol, UK. Start Date: March - May 2026 Eligibility: Candidates must be eligible to work in the UK to apply for this role. GenomeKey is not able to offer visa sponsorship. Company: GenomeKey is a Bristol based biotech startup developing a next-generation diagnostic device for bloodstream infections, using machine learning and DNA sequencing. Within GenomeKey we provide an encouraging environment where knowledge is shared and professional development is supported across both technical and non-technical skillsets. Join GenomeKey to help build a world where nobody dies from a treatable infection. Role Responsibilities: We are seeking a constantly inquisitive, creative and broadly skilled Mechanical Engineer to assist in developing active systems to operate within GenomeKey’s innovative ecosystem. You will be working alongside a talented and dedicated team of engineers and scientists working on exciting products with real world, life saving applications. Your responsibilities will include: Developing mechanical actuation and control methods for GenomeKey’s automated biochemical processing platform, supporting the transition from research prototypes to integrated systems and devices and subsequent optimisation. Collaborating with engineering and scientific colleagues to ensure robust system-level integration. Design and develop mechanical components and assemblies including enclosures, internal frames, cartridge interfaces, and precision mechanisms, including miniaturised versions of the same. Apply DfMA principles to enable scalable, cost-effective production. Support prototyping activities, including hands-on build, modification, and iteration of mechanical designs. Support development and maintenance of mechanical design documentation in line with design control requirements. Participate in risk management activities, including design reviews. Contribute to verification, validation, and reliability testing in collaboration with the Test Engineer. Provide technical guidance and support to junior engineering staff on mechanical design and manufacture. Key: MEng (or equivalent Master’s degree) in mechanical engineering. Minimum of 3 years industry experience. Practical, hands-on experience of mechanical design for complex electromechanical systems Familiarity with manufacturing processes such as 3D printing, machining, and sheet metal fabrication. Proven ability to plan, schedule, and deliver complex projects independently. Clear communication of design strategy and choices to both internal and external stakeholders. Proficiency with Fusion360 or similar CAD software and production of detailed engineering drawings. Ability to conduct rapid, fail fast iterative prototyping during early-stage development with the rigour of ISO 13485 or compliance as the product matures. Adaptability and resilience to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ic startup environment. Excellent verbal and written communication skills. Desirable: Experience in the Medical Device industry or in laboratory automation. Experience taking designs from concept through prototyping and test. Experience applying the rigour of ISO 13485 or similar compliance standards as the product matures. Knowledge of electrical circuit design and electromechanical and fluidic systems. Prior experience with design for manufacturing and assembly. Experience developing products under Design Controls.
